From what I understand, it was originally a regular article series in a Japanese tabletop gaming magazine dramatizing the events of a D&D campaign (since it was the 80s, probably playing the first edition of the game with a Japanese localization). I’m not sure what the process was getting it adapted to an anime, but they managed to do so.

Sheikah are the long-lived ones, not Hylians. As far as we know Hylians have around the same lifespan as humans, if not barely longer.
Hylians live as long as humans except when Sheika tech or magic are involved. Only the Hyrulean royal family is depicted as such, the rest of hylians are typically farmers or merchants. They do have pointed ears so they could hear the voices of the goddesses (although every Hylian has lost that ability since except for Link) Only Zelda has magic powers because she is a descendant of Hylia herself. All other Hylians are like normal people, just with pointed ears.
